Michael Carrick is closing in on Man Utd’s fourth major signing of the summer (Photo: Getty) Carlos Baleba may have to play out of position at Manchester United if Michael Carrick fails to land his top transfer target. The Brighton star is expected to complete a long-anticipated move to Old Trafford in the coming days, with the two clubs close to agreeing a deal worth up to £65million. United fans will have to wait a little while for his debut however, with Baleba currently sidelined with an ankle ligament injury. The 22-year-old will compete for a spot in Carrick’s midfield engine room against Kobbie Mainoo, Mason Mount and fellow summer signings Youri Tielemans and Andrey Santos. But he may well be deployed in a new role for the Red Devils, with the club struggling to sign a left-back before deadline day on September. The Athletic report that after the arrival of Tielemans and Santos, United’s focus switched to recruiting cover and competition for Luke Shaw – the only natural left-back in the first-team. But when the injury-prone Mount suffered another setback in pre-season, the recruitment team decided to look at players capable of operating both in midfield and at full-back. Carlos Baleba has NEVER played at left-back (Photo: Getty) Targets included Arsenal teenager Myles Lewis-Skelly and Real Madrid’s Eduardo Camavinga but with both unattainable, they pivoted back to Baleba. Baleba has never played at left-back before but is left-footed and has previously filled in as a centre-back for Brighton. It is reported that the Cameroon international will be considered to play there if need be, a scenario that will surely arise with Carrick struggling to get a defender through the door before before the transfer window closes. Luke Shaw is Man Utd’s only first-team left-back (Photo: Getty) United’s top left-back targets are Lewis Hall and Joaquin Seys but Newcastle United and Club Brugge are adamant they are going nowhere this summer. Barcelona’s Alejandro Balde is the latest name linked with Old Trafford, with United holding talks with the Spain international’s agent. Additionally, Diogo Dalot, Noussair Mazraoui, Lisandro Martinez and Patrick Dorgu have all covered at left-back before, but none are considered naturals in that position. Joaquin Seys is valued at £30m by Club Brugge (Photo: Getty) Club Brugge manager Ivan Leko admits he is ‘proud’ to see Joaquin Seys linked with a big money transfer to Manchester United and Arsenal. And Leko has conceded that it would be ‘hard to say no’ to selling his star defender this summer, if the right offer was made. Seys has been tipped to move to the Premier League following an excellent 2025/26 season, in which he won the Belgium Pro League and reached the quarter-finals of the World Cup. Newcastle United, Aston Villa, Porto and Benfica have also been linked with the highly-rated 21-year-old who is valued at £30million by Brugge. Signing a new left-back is now Man Utd’s top priority until the end of the transfer window, though Flemish outlet Het Nieuwsblad claim that they are yet to make a formal approach for the player. With Patrick Dorgu now viewed as a winger by Michael Carrick, Luke Shaw is the only natural left-back in the squad and surely cannot be relied upon for a full season with Champions League football given his injury history. After selling Christos Tzolis to Arsenal for £34m earlier this summer, do not want to lose anymore of their prized assets including Seys and Barcelona target Nicolò Tresoldi. Seys impressed at th World Cup for Belgium (Photo: Getty) Nevertheless, Leko is happy to see his players linked with Europe’s top club, admitting as much in an interview ahead of Brugge’s 3-0 win over Oud-Heverlee Leuven on Saturday. ‘In fact, I’m proud that my guys are being linked to those clubs,’ he said. ‘We chat about it every now and then. How much of those rumours is true? I don’t know. But we all have eyes in our heads: their potential is incredible. Seys was in action for Club Brugge over the weekend (Photo: Getty) ‘On the other hand, they remain consummate professionals and are happy here. The focus is entirely on OHL.’ Leko previously claimed Seys was destined to play at the top of the Premier League and believes there is a chance he will move on before deadline day. ‘If there’s a lot of money on the table, it’s obviously not easy to say no,’ He added. ‘The board’s aim is still to build a team that’s even better than last season. ‘The right time to leave will come.
